Nepal Elections 2026: Voting Ends Peacefully, Key Results Expected Soon Amidst Turmoil
•
Voting for Nepal's 2026 general elections concluded peacefully across all seven provinces.
•
Results for 165 direct contest seats anticipated within 24 hours; 110 proportional representation seats in 2-3 days.
•
Key figures include former PM KP Sharma Oli, Nepali Congress leader Gagan Thapa, and new face Balen Shah.
•
Elections follow a year of political turmoil, Gen-Z protests, and an interim government's promise.
•
Nepal uses a mixed electoral system: First Past the Post for 165 seats and Proportional Representation for 110 seats.
